Solo Dining Delight at STK Ibiza: A High-Energy Experience

Nestled in the exclusive and sophisticated Marina Botafoch in Ibiza Town, STK Ibiza offers a high-energy dining experience that seamlessly blends a premium steakhouse with exhilarating live entertainment. Despite its reputation as a perfect venue for a night out with friends or family, my solo dining experience at STK Ibiza was nothing short of spectacular.

I arrived for the first sitting at 8 PM. Although the restaurant was initially quiet, it soon began to fill up with groups of friends, all dressed to impress in accordance with the smart casual dress code—no open shoes, no swimming/sport shorts, and no tank tops allowed for gentlemen, with the exception of smart and chino shorts. By 9 PM, the place was buzzing, and the night had transformed into a full-on entertainment experience with great music, singers, and dancers appearing every 30 minutes.

STK Ibiza offers a choice of two seating areas: The Black Carpet – Main Area, located closer to the stage with signature STK booths, and the El Bistro area, located by the bar and the DJ. Families with children are welcome during the first seating at 8 PM, with dinner in the Bistro area lasting for two hours. I opted for The Black Carpet, allowing me to be closer to the stage and fully immerse myself in the vibrant atmosphere.

STK Ibiza caters to various dietary preferences, including vegetarian, vegan, and gluten-free options. For my solo dining adventure, I entrusted Victoria with the task of making recommendations, and I was delighted with her choices: Bluefin Tuna Tartare with avocado and yucca crisps in a soy-honey emulsion, Burrata with beef heart tomato and buffalo mozzarella, followed by Mac & Cheese, steak with grilled vegetables, sweet potato fries, and to finish, a delectable Lemon Pie.

The highlight of the evening was undoubtedly the cocktails and entertainment. I tried the very theatrical Green Forest, a tequila-based cocktail with distilled pine, green chartreuse, and cucumber juice. Even though one was definitely enough, I was persuaded to try the Cleopatra, crafted from Bombay Sapphire Gin, Chardonnay, rosemary, and crème de Mure, and it did not disappoint.

From start to finish, the staff at STK Ibiza were incredibly attentive to all guests. The restaurant exuded a nightclub vibe, making it a unique dining experience. Although the food and drink are quite expensive, with steaks starting around €40 and a minimum spend of €150 per head in the Black Carpet area, the combination of the amazing atmosphere, delectable food, and captivating entertainment makes it worth every euro.

As a solo traveller, I found STK Ibiza to be an excellent place to soak up the party atmosphere, enjoy wonderful food, and be entertained. While I might not return alone, I will definitely be back with my girlfriends to explore more of their enticing cocktails and revel in another unforgettable night.
